Region: Coastal Plain
County Seat: Hertford (1758)
Population: 11,3681
|
Perquimans County was formed as early as 1668 as a precinct of Albemarle County. It is in the northeastern section of the State and is bounded by Albemarle Sound and Chowan, Gates and Pasquotank counties.
Hertford, established in 1758 on the land of Jonathan Phelps, is the county seat.2
